概括
奇拉表面表现出异体特异性结合,其中一个异体比另一个更强地结合. 这种选择性吸附来自于优化性分子和表面之间的多个局部键.

主要成果:
- 在HSCH2CHNH2CH2P(CH3) 2的 (S) - 反体比在Au 17 11 9表面的 (R) - 反体更强烈地结合8.8kJ/mol.
- 乙特异性结合归因于表面曲部位的奇拉性质.
- 在相似的条件下,相关的性分子 (氨酸,氨酸) 没有表现出因子特异性结合.
- 局部绑定模型强调了三个接触点的同时优化作为enantiospecificity的起源.
- 分子经历显著的变形以优化键,而表面变形较少.
结论:
- 嵌合体Au ((17 11 9) 表面对某些嵌合体分子表现出异构特异性吸附.
- Enantiospecificity 源于多个局部相互作用的合作优化.
- 局部结合模型为理解性吸附现象提供了一个框架.

Density and Archimedes' Principle
When a lump of clay is dropped into water, it sinks. But if the same lump of clay is molded into the shape of a boat, it starts to float. Because of its shape, the clay boat displaces more water than the lump and experiences a greater buoyant force, even though its mass is the same. The same holds true for steel ships. Boundary Conditions for Current Density
Current density becomes discontinuous across an interface of materials with different electrical conductivities. The normal component of the current density is continuous across the boundary.
